SYNOPSIS:
A large area of moisture and instability, associated with interaction of an upper level feature and a tropical wave at the surface will produce cloudiness and scattered showers, some of which could be heavy along with isolated thunder. Motorists and residents are advised to remain vigilant due to the possibility of urban flooding.
Winds are forecasted to increase this weekend, and seas are also expected to increase to near 8 feet by Saturday. A small craft advisory will come into effect at 8pm tonight.
